Can You Use Skill in Deal or No Deal

Once in a blue moon a TV series gets aired our screen that blows all of the others away and the same can be said for Deal or No Deal. The show was very innovative as it was one of the first that did not involve answering questions. The aim of the game is to open the numbers until you get them down to the last one. Through the game the banker will call and try and persuade you to give up your box for an offer, a lot of people end up giving in and deal, but when the game finished it emerges that they of in fact won a whole lot more.

Don't get me wrong some people deal at exactly the right down and end up beating the banker as they like to phrase it. But you have to ask yourself the question whether the show is purely about luck or the ability to be a gambler?

Well the answer in my opinion is both, Deal or No Deal is more like playing roulette than rakeback, the reason for saying this is because roulette is a probability game exactly like Deal or No Deal. The chance comes in when you are selecting the boxes, if you choose the wrong boxes then you are going to end up getting low offers, but the thing about it is that if you have brought a high figure box to the table, then whatever happens you are going to end up getting an enourmous offer at the final moments.

The moment that you have to start poutting your gambling hat on is when you get big offers, you have to look at things such as probabilities and more.
